Oreapolis, Nebraska facts for kids
Oreapolis is a small, quiet place in Cass County, Nebraska, in the United States. It's known as an "unincorporated community," which means it doesn't have its own local government like a city or town does. Instead, it's managed by the county.
A Glimpse into Oreapolis's Past
Oreapolis had a special role for a short time in the mid-1800s. A post office was opened there in 1859. This post office helped people send and receive letters and packages, which was very important for communication back then. However, it didn't stay open for long. The post office closed its doors in 1864.
